Transaction fc8112e06159184204c566dfd7fbbdd30a9e78bb604a07705bd129a1574486a4
1 Input
1 Output
-
fc8112e06159184204c566dfd7fbbdd30a9e78bb604a07705bd129a1574486a4:0
- value
- 3463394
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d0beb9798b842aba663ea238e6f31bb0fccba59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CQBkDScegq7e5hJ4fgXgwCGCyk8YxUihU